About Parkview Gardens
Parkview Gardens is a residential care home in Barrow-in-furness, in the Westmorland and Furness council area, registered with the Care Quality Commission for up to 60 residents. It provides care for people living with dementia, older people, younger adults, people with a physical disability and people with a sensory impairment. It is run by Westmorland and Furness Council, which operates 10 care homes in England. The home has been registered since April 2023.
At its latest inspection, published December 2023, the CQC rated Parkview Gardens Good, which means the CQC found the service performing well and meeting its expectations. Ratings can change after a new inspection, so check the CQC report before you visit.
Parkview Gardens has not published its fees and we are still collecting figures for Westmorland and Furness. Across England residential care usually costs £900 to £1,400 a week and nursing care £1,200 to £1,900. Ask the home for a written quote that lists what is included.

Does Parkview Gardens provide nursing care?
No. Parkview Gardens is registered as a care home without nursing. Staff provide personal care; visiting district nurses cover nursing needs.
